for语句是循环控制结构中使用最广泛的一种循环控制语句,特别适合已知循环次数的情况。 一般形式如下: for ( [表达式 1]; [表达式 2 ]; [表达式3] ) 语句 其中: 表达式1:一般为赋值表达式,给控制变量赋初值; for语句 表达式2:关系表达式或逻辑表达式,循环控制条件; 表达式3:一般为赋值表达式,给控制变量增量或减...
建议for语句的循环控制变量的取值采用“前闭后开区间”写法 代码语言:javascript 复制 int i=0;//前闭后开的写法for(i=0;i<10;i++){}//两边都是闭区间for(i=0;i<=9;i++){} 2.3 for循环变种 for循环中的初始化部分,判断部分,调整部分是可以省略的。 初始化部分省略:循环中无法初始化循环变量,可能...
在C语言中,for语句是一种非常强大的循环控制结构,用于重复执行一段代码直到满足特定条件为止。它的基本语法如下: c for (初始化表达式; 循环条件; 步进表达式) { // 循环体 } 用法及规则详解 初始化表达式:在循环开始前执行,通常用于初始化循环控制变量。例如,int i = 0;。 循环条件:在每次循环迭代之前评估...
# include <stdio.h># include <math.h>//要用sqrt()intmain(void){inti;//循环变量intx;//存储每个数的二次方根for(i=1;i<1000;++i){x=sqrt(i);/*如果i不是完全平方数, 那么sqrt(i)肯定是小数, 而i是int型, 所以x是sqrt(i)取整后的值, 这样x*x肯定不等于i*/if(x*x==i){printf("%d...
三、使用for实现数组元素求和 除了可以用于计算数列和外,for循环也常被用来对数组进行遍历并进行相应处理。下面是一个例子,演示如何使用for循环计算数组元素的和: ```c #include <stdio.h> #define SIZE 5 int main() { int numbers[SIZE] = {1, 2, 3, 4, 5}; int sum = 0; for (int i = 0;...
1、注意for语句括号中三个部分均是语句,用分号“;”隔开。而且,三个语句均可以省略,可以省略部分或全部。2、循环体尽量设置简洁,不必要的操作尽量安排在循环体之外。如计算1到100的求和,有人写出如下循环:int i,tmp,sum;for(tmp=0,sum=0,i=1;i<101;i++){ tmp +=i;sum = tmp;} 上述循环中,...
for(i=1;i<=10;i++) { sum+=i; } for函数可以用来进行循环汇总,即对一系列数据进行累加或累乘操作。在上面的示例中,循环从1到10,每次循环将循环计数器i的值加到sum变量上。最终,sum的值为1+2+3+…+10,即55。 这种用法在处理某些需要对数据进行累计运算的情况下非常有用,比如计算数组元素之和。 7....
⛳️我们来上看上面那个问题用for怎么编写? 使用for循环 在屏幕上打印1-10的数字。 但是要用continue-结束5的打印 📚代码演示: 代码语言:javascript 复制 #include<stdio.h>intmain(){int i=0;//for(i=1/*初始化*/; i<=10/*判断部分*/; i++/*调整部分*/)for(i=1;i<=10;i++){if(i==...
for(i = 0; i < 10; i++) { //在这里编写你要重复执行的代码 } ``` 3.递增 每次成功完成一轮迭代之后,递增步骤都会被执行。它通常用于更新控制变量(可能是计数器或索引),使得下一次迭代满足新的条件。 示例: ``` int i; for(i = 0; i < 10; i++) { //在这里编写你要重复执行的代码 }...
C语言中的for语句是一种常用的循环控制结构,它可以执行一个代码块若干次,直到指定的循环次数完成或者循环条件不再满足。for语句的基本使用格式包括初始化表达式、循环条件和迭代表达式。具体语法为for (初始化表达式; 循环条件; 迭代表达式) { 循环体; }。其中,初始化表达式通常用于设置循环计数变量的初始值,循环条件...